XMLReader implementation and a virtual Reader/Writer template framework.
Test_serialisation has an example of *code* *free* object serialisation to both ostream and to XML using macro magic. Implementing TextReader/TextWriter, YAML, JSON etc.. should be trivial and we can use configure time options to select the default "Reader" typedef. Present done with "using XMLPolicy::Reader" to pick up the default serialisation strategy.
